The Chief Drive-In Theatre is a historic drive-in theatre located in the town of Chickasha, Oklahoma. It first opened its doors in 1949 and has been providing movie-goers with a unique and nostalgic experience for over 70 years. The theatre has survived multiple closures and changes in ownership but has remained a beloved local landmark throughout its history.

The Chief Drive-In Theatre was originally built by a man named W.D. Hummingbird. At the time of its opening, it was one of only a handful of drive-in theatres in the state of Oklahoma. The theatre featured a single screen and could simultaneously accommodate up to 500 cars. The opening night featured the classic film “The Red Stallion,” and quickly became a popular destination for movie-goers in the area.

Over the years, the Chief Drive-In Theatre has seen its fair share of challenges. In the 1960s, the theatre was forced to close due to financial struggles. However, it was reopened a few years later by a new owner, and continued to operate throughout the 1970s and 1980s.

In the 1990s, the theatre once again faced closure as attendance declined and competition from indoor movie theatres increased. However, in 1994, a local couple named Joe and Lisa DeLong purchased the theatre and worked to revitalize it. They added a second screen and began showing double features, which proved to be a successful strategy.

In the years since, the Chief Drive-In Theatre has continued to thrive under the ownership of the DeLongs. The theatre has become a popular destination for families and groups of friends looking for a fun and unique movie-going experience. One of the unique features of the Chief Drive-In Theatre is its large, neon-lit sign. The sign features a caricature of a Native American chief, which is a nod to the history and culture of the area. The sign has become a symbol of the theatre and a popular spot for photos.

The theatre’s website notes that the Chief Drive-In is “more than just a movie theatre.” In addition to showing movies, the theatre hosts events throughout the year, including car shows, flea markets, and live music performances. The theatre also offers a concession stand with classic movie snacks like popcorn and candy and burgers and other food items.

The Chief Drive-In Theatre is also known for its affordable ticket prices. According to the theatre’s website, a carload of up to six people can see a double feature for just $20. This makes it an affordable option for families and groups of friends looking for a fun night out.
